Choosing appropriate toys and materials is also an significant part the child care provider's occupation. There's mr immortal for all ages. To Choose the best toys for a specific child care program or classroom, ask yourself the following questions:
Just how old are the children? Babies just learning how to crawl need different toys than active preschoolers or interested school-age kids.
Which are the kids most interested in right now? Young toddlers that are developing motor skills might need climbing equipment. Preschool Paper experts can like dinosaur puzzles, toys and books. Bear in mind that children's interests and skills change as they get old, so toys may need to be rotated regularly.
Which are the children learning? A kid just beginning to draw likely needs big, chunky crayons. A kindergartner who's mastering writing may favor smaller crayons or fine-tipped mark to draw. Pick materials that encourage children to choose another step in their own development.
How do I support children's growth in different places? Be certain to pick toys that promote large-motor, small-motor and thinking abilities, as well as social skills and self-awareness.
When choosing toys and materials for your child care plan, remember, simpler is usually better. Toys do not have to be expensive or have lots of bells and whistles to be good learning programs for young children.
